They Can Help You Collect Evidence

It is essential to begin collecting evidence as soon you realize that you've been injured in a car accident. This will help you make an evidence-based case in the event that the insurance company or another party tries to deny your claim.

Photographs and witness testimony are two of the most important pieces evidence that lawyers for car accidents will gather to prove your case. Because they can provide the entire accident scene and include any traffic control devices like stop signs or signals, as well as the weather and environmental conditions that could have caused the accident This is a crucial piece of evidence.

In addition, photographs can document the victim's injuries and damage to property. You can also use photos to prove that the other driver was responsible for your injuries or damages.

If possible, take photos from several angles of the scene using your smartphone. Also, record any debris or skid marks. This will help you prove that the other driver was driving in a reckless manner prior to the collision, or did not see a red light and drove into your vehicle which led to the collision.

You should also gather the names and contact numbers of witnesses. This will allow your lawyer to show that the other driver was accountable for your injuries and damages.

You should also collect the names of license numbers, names and insurance information of all other drivers involved in the crash. This will assist your lawyer make a convincing case that the other driver was at fault for the crash, car accident lawyer and it will also prevent them from changing their story should they decide to pursue an insurance claim against you in the future.

An attorney can help you gather evidence to support your claim, including medical records and the statements of healthcare professionals. These are essential to prove that you sustained physical injuries and medical damages as a result of the accident, and the severity of these injuries and how they affect your capacity to work and your life to come.

The damages you might be eligible to recover in your case are divided into two categories: non-economic and economic. The first category covers your monetary losses, which includes past, present and future expenses including lost wages, damages to property, medical care and other associated expenses.

You could also be able recover other damages that aren't economic, like pain and suffering, emotional distress, disfigurement loss of enjoyment of life and other damages that don't have any specific value in terms of money.
